Prague Ruzyne airport is the largest airport of the Czech republic. A Marriot hotel is connected by walking bridge with the terminals. In 2008 almost 12 million passengers used this airport. There are main 2 terminals, but you can walk between them als they are adiacent buildings. The airport is the home of CSA Czech airlines in 2011. Prague international airport (PRG)

Terminals: The airport main terminals are totally connected.

Bus: With bus 119 you can reach the end of metro line A in 2010. There is very good frequency on this route. Metro line A will take you right to downtown Prague. Exit Mustek.

Hotel: There is a Marriot hotel really connected to the main airport terminals, so within walking distance. The Holiday Inn is further away and can be reached by shuttle.

Country: Prague airport (PRG) is the only major international gateway of the Czech Republic.

Airlines: CSA Czech airlines - WizzAir - Easyjet - KLM - Brussels airlines - Lufthansa - Austrian
